Powerhouse pair into Women’s Championship final
Hosts Zimbabwe will play defending champions South Africa in the final of the 2011 COSAFA Women’s Championship after the semifinal matches played on Thursday at the Rufaro Stadium in Harare. The home side edged past East African guests Tanzania after a 4-2 penalty shout-out win while South Africa overwhelmed Malawi to claim a 5-1 victory.
